Overview
The park was named after General John Coffee,
a planter, U.S. Congressman and military leader.
Seventeen Mile River flows through the park and creates six small lakes as it winds
through cypress swamp. Many species of wildlife, including the threatened indigo snake and
gopher tortoise, may be found here. The agricultural history of the county is interpreted
at the Heritage Farm, a living history farm with cabins, farm animals and outdoor
exhibits.

Hiking & Biking
Several miles of well-marked foot trails meander through the park. The trail
takes you through cypress swamp and a mixture of pine and hardwood forest. There are some
very nice views of the Dan Lake.

Heritage Farm
As you enter the gates of General Coffee State Park, you will be greeted by Heritage Farm
- a living history museum for the park. Within the village you will find three original
log structures, a corn crib, chicken coupe, cane mill, syrup shelter, blacksmith shop,
privy, antique equipment and smoke house.
Village residents (turkeys, genies, chickens, etc.) welcomes visitors daily. Stroll the
village walks and turn back time.
Visit the Meeks Cabin, an authentic 1828 home place. Rest a spell in the Relihan Museum
where guests can enjoy educational wildlife programs, or seek shade under the tin roof of
a century old log tobacco barn. Visit the turpentine exhibit, take a hike on the nature
trail.
